首页计算机书籍程序设计《C++程序设计 第二版》杨长兴 刘卫国
MAXEND

文档

223

关注

0

好评

0
PDF

《C++程序设计 第二版》杨长兴 刘卫国

阅读 862 下载 0 大小 26.18M 总页数 315 页 2022-11-17 分享
价格:¥ 10.00
下载文档
/ 315
全屏查看
《C++程序设计 第二版》杨长兴 刘卫国
还有 315 页未读 ,您可以 继续阅读 或 下载文档
1、本文档共计 315 页,下载后文档不带www.pdfdz.com水印,支持完整阅读内容。
2、古籍基本都为PDF扫描版,所以文档不支持编辑功能,即不支持文档内文字的复制粘贴。
3、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
4、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
5、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。
内容提要本书以程序设计零基础为起点,全面介绍包括面向过程和面向对象的C+程序设计方法。全书共10章,包括C+基础知识、程序控制结构、函数与编译预处理、数组与指针、自定义数据类型、类与对象、重载与模板、继承与派生、多态性与虚函数、输入输出流。各章节内容由浅入深、相互衔接、前后呼应、循序渐进。为了提高读者对程序设计思想方法的理解,本书将程序设计语言模型与人类自然语言模型相比较,让读者对程序设计语言模型及其内容的理解有了完整的参照对象。全书各章节选用大量程序设计经典实例来讲解基本概念和程序设计方法,同时配有大量习题供读者练习。本书的配套教材《C+程序设计实践教程》(第二版)提供了本课程的实践内容、上机指导及习题参考答案。本书语言表达严谨,文字流畅,内容通俗易懂、重点突出、实例丰富。适为高等院校各专业程序设计课程的教材,还适为广大计算机爱好者的自学参考用书。本书配有免费电子教案,读者可以从中国水利水电出版社网站以及万水书苑下载,网址为:htp:/,waterpub/softdown/或:/.wookshow,com。图书在版编目(CIP)数据C+程序设计/杨长兴,刘卫国主编.一2版.-北京:中国水利水电出版社,2012.1普通高等教育“十二五”规划教材ISBN978-7-5084-9364-0C语言一程序设计一高等学校一教材V.①TP312中国版本图书馆CIP数据核字(2011)第281393号策划编辑:雷顺加责任编辑:李炎封面设计:李佳书名普通高等教育“十二五”规划教材C++程序设计(第二版)作者主编杨长兴刘卫国副主编曹岳辉李利明出版发行中国水利水电出版社(北京市海淀区玉渊潭南路1号D座100038)网址:.waterpubE-il:mchannel(@263.net(万水)sales@waterpub电话:(010)68367658(发行部)、82562819(万水)经售北京科水图书销售中心(零售)电话:(010)88383994、63202643、68545874全国各地新华书店和相关出版物销售网点排版北京万水电子信息有限公司印刷北京蓝空印刷厂规格184mmX260mm16开本19.75印张480千字次2008年1月第1版第1次印刷2012年1月第2版2012年1月第1次印刷印数0001一5000册定价35.00元凡购买我社图书,如有缺页、倒页、脱页的,本社发行部负责调换·前言目前,随着计算机技术的普及与提高,高校计算机基础教学的内容也在不断改革与发展。程序设计课程是大学生必须掌握的计算机基本知识。选用某种程序设计语言作为高校大学生程序设计课程的语言环境,是各校计算机基础教学工作者改革研究的课题之一。过去很长一段时间,许多高校选用C语言作为程序设计课程的语言。但随着软件工程技术的不断发展,面向对象的程序设计方法已成为当今软件开发的重要手段之一,尤其是Visual C+的出现,进一步推动了面向对象与可视化编程技术的发展与应用。因此,掌握面向对象的程序设计方法已经成为大学生计算机应用与软件开发能力的要求之一。由于C++兼容了C语言的功能强、效率高、风格简洁、满足包括系统程序设计和应用程序设计的大多数任务的特点,又扩充了面向对象部分,即支持类、继承、派生、多态性等,解决了其代码的重用问题,C++实际上是既支持面向过程的结构化程序设计又支持面向对象的程序设计的语言。所以,我们根据多年的实际教学经验,在程序设计课程教学改革研究时,选用C++作为程序设计课程的语言环境。对于本书内容的选择,我们力求面向读者,以程序设计零基础为起点,全面介绍了包括面向过程和面向对象的C++程序没计方法。让读者首先接受面向对象的程序设计的思想方法,并理解面向对象的程序设计是需要以面向过程的程序设计方法作为基础的。全书共分为10章,第1章介绍C++的基础知识:第2章介绍程序控制结构:第3章介绍函数:第4章介绍数组与指针:第5章介绍自定义数据类型:第6章介绍类与对象:第7章介绍重载与模板:第8章介绍继承与派生:第9章介绍多态性与虚函数:第10章介绍输入输出流。从全书组织结构来看,首先定位C+是兼顾面向过程和面向对象的程序设计语言,面向对象的程序设计是以面向过程的程序设计为基础的。因此,在第1~5章以介绍面向过程的程序设计为主:在第6~10章以介绍面向对象的基本思想与方法为主。本书编者长期从事程序设计课程的教学工作,并利用C/C+Visual C++开发了许多软件,具有丰富的教学经验和较强的科学研究能力。编者本着加强基础、注重实践、突出应用、勇于创新的原则,力求使本书达到有较强的可读性、适用性和先进性。我们的教学理念是:教学是教思想、教方法,真正做到“授人以鱼,不如授人以渔”。为了加强读者对程序设计思想方法的理解,本书将程序设计语言模型与人类自然语言模型相比较,让读者对程序设计语言模型及其内容的理解有了完整的参照对象。为了提高读者的编程技巧,选用了大量的经典例题,这些例题与相应章节的基本内容是完全吻合的,而且读者对这些例题的自然解法是相当熟悉的。例题还备有多种可能的解答,以期拓展读者的解题思路。为了便于读者自学,在全书的内容组织、编排上注重由浅入深、深入浅出、循序渐进。因此,本书适为高等院校各专业程序设计课程的教材,也适广大计算机爱好者的自学参考用书。如教师选用本书作为大学生程序设计课程的教材,可根据实际教学课时数调整或取舍内容。本书所给出的程序示例均在Visual C++6.0环境下进行了调试和运行。为了帮助读者更好地学习C++,编者还编写了配套教材《C+程序设计实践教程》(第二版)一书,该配套教材提供了本课程的实践内容、上机指导及习题参考答案。
返回顶部